Do (pentaarylcyclopentadienyl)molybdenum(vi) dioxo species catalyse alkene epoxidations? Insights from kinetics data

Abstract

A (perarylcyclopentadienyl)molybdenum(VI) dioxo complex is shown to catalyse epoxidation of cyclooctene by t-butylhydroperoxide, but decomposition to a much more active non-cyclopentadienyl containing catalyst occurs as the reaction proceeds.
